Research On The Key Techonolgy Of Grid-Based Distributed Simulation System

With the rapid development of science and technology, it becomes more and morenecessary for researchers to use the techniques of modeling and simulation. The Modelingand simulation not only become an important tool in exploring the nature, discoverbiological mystery, opening aerospace field, and hovering the universe etc. but alsobecome an important method for people to share information resources and eliminate theisland of information. With the driving force from the sustained growth of the military, thebusiness and the requirement of scientific research, the modeling and simulationtechnology have experinced rapid development. Traditional distributed simulationtechnologies are not enough for people to share all kinds of simulation resources due tothe lack of load balance ability. Thus, the utilization rate of computational resource is lowand the system is hard to scale. Therefore, they can not adapt to the requirement of peoplefor large-scale complex simulations. With the expansion of the scale of simulation and theshart increase in requirements, these problems become the bottleneck in distributedsimulations.In order to overcome the shortcoming of traditional distributed simulationtechnologies, we propose the architecture of the high-level support system for gridservices. We divide the architecture into two parts: the grid-based RTI module and theinformation integration and management center module of RTI scheduling. Based on thearchitecture, we further propose the agent-based request callback mechanism, thegrid-based simulation module standard and the fault mechanism of grid-based simulationservice. The combination of the grid technology and the distributed simulation technologyprovides a solution for building the high-level support system of grid service. Therefore,the strategy is very practical in real applications.Existing simulation technologies usually passively choose tasks and service resourcesand lack the description of service characteristics of resources and the constraints ofservice ability. To cope with the problems, we propose an optimization mechanism forgrid-based distributed simulation tasks scheduling. In the mechanism, we first propose anoptimization scheduling theory model about service based on the characteristics of grid service. Then, we use the model to distribute tasks. Thus, it is impossible that the problemof performance bottleneck appears when the service resources are providing services fordifferent tasks. By using such mechanism, the problem about the unreasonable allocationof service resources and the poor scalability of system can be resolved.To address the problem of how to control the quality of service of system and managethe system resources, we propose a resource management mechanism mainly consideringthe quality of service. In the mechanism, we first set up a resource management modelbased on the resource management and its operation state. Based on the model, wepropose the forecast method about the quality of service of the system and the resourceallocation algorithm. All these constitute the management mechanism of system resourcesoriented the quality of service of system. By using the mechanism, the problem includingthe low quality of service and the lack of flexibility are resolved.In order to overcome the shortcoming of the current collection scheme of simulationdata, we propose a data resource mechanism according to the characteristics of grid-baseddistributed simulation. Specifically, in the mechanism, there is a data collection model, ananalysis method for data collection, a polymetization method for data collection, a storagemethod for data collection, a data collection module, a simulation application module ofclient, a data collection module of server, a data collection module of client, etc. In themechanism, the service is the main function. This makes the grid-based HLA distributionsimulation system have the good generality, interoperability and reusability.All in all, the system will have the features of high-level distribution, standards, highscalability and so on based on the above research results in the grid-based distributedsimulation system.
